Uber Eats is hiring an Outbound Account Executive to drive growth in a fast-paced SMB sales team.
You will own a true 360 outbound sales cycle—discovery, pitching, and closing partnerships with local restaurants and independent merchants.
This role emphasizes new business acquisition with strategic account management elements.
You will manage high-velocity outbound activities, maintain CRM data hygiene, and collaborate cross-functionally to optimize merchant onboarding and upsell op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Uber
✨Know Your Sales Methodologies
Brush up on popular sales methodologies like SPIN Selling or Challenger Sales. Being able to discuss these techniques and how you've applied them will show Uber that you understand the role and can hit the ground running in the sales game.
✨Demonstrate Your Deal-Making Skills
Prepare to share stories from your past experiences where you closed deals, overcame objections, or started new client relationships. We want to show Uber that you’re not just about numbers but also about building lasting connections in business development.
✨Prepare for Role-Play Scenarios
In a full-time sales interview, don’t be surprised if they throw in a role-play exercise to test your pitching skills. Practising how you would pitch a product or handle an objection will help us shine in this simulation—think of it like a dress rehearsal for your future sales calls!
